Compel Alacrity - The mesmerist can trigger this trick when the subject begins her turn within an enemy’s reach. The subject can move 10 feet as a free action without provoking attacks of opportunity. The distance the subject can move increases by 5 feet for every 5 levels the mesmerist possesses, to a maximum of 30 feet at 20th level. The subject can’t move farther than her speed in this way. The movement from this trick doesn’t count against the subject’s movement speed for that round. False Flanker - A duplicate of the mesmerist appears momentarily, as though he were fighting in tandem with the subject. The mesmerist can trigger this trick when the subject moves into or begins her turn in a square where she threatens an enemy. An illusory duplicate of the mesmerist appears in any unoccupied space adjacent to that enemy. This duplicate counts as threatening the enemy for the purposes of determining flanking, but can’t actually make attacks. The duplicate disappears at the end of the turn during which the trick is triggered. This is an illusion (figment) effect, and a creature that interacts with the false flanker can attempt a saving throw to disbelieve the effect. Meek Façade - The subject magically seems like a weak target, goading an enemy into attacking her. The mesmerist can trigger this trick when the subject misses a creature with an attack (even if it’s part of a full attack in which she hits that creature with another attack). The enemy must attack no one other than the subject, and the subject gains a +2 dodge bonus to AC against the triggering enemy’s attacks. Both of these effects last for 1 round. ══♜══╣Background╠══♜══ Childhood:
Sir Tandyn was raised by crusaders to be another crusader. He and his friends all had carefully curated childhoods to ensure that one day they would follow in their parents' footsteps. The temple of Iomedae was like a second home, and whenever his parents would leave on rotation, it was. He never really had to wonder who he was and was consistently praised for doing as he was told. It was a happy, regimented childhood. The Demon:
